Modern vehicles are equipped with a sophisticated system known as the engine control module (ECM), also referred to as the powertrain control module (PCM) or engine control unit (ECU).

This crucial component plays a pivotal role in ensuring the optimal performance, fuel efficiency, and overall operation of the vehicle.

The engine control module is essentially the brain of the vehicle, responsible for monitoring and controlling various functions of the engine and transmission system. It gathers data from sensors placed throughout the vehicle, analyzes the information, and adjusts parameters accordingly to ensure the proper functioning of the engine and transmission.

One of the primary functions of the ECM is to regulate the air-fuel mixture in the engine. By analyzing data from the oxygen sensor, mass airflow sensor, and other sensors, the ECM can adjust the fuel injection and ignition timing to achieve the ideal air-fuel ratio for combustion. This process helps to optimize engine performance, improve fuel efficiency, and reduce harmful emissions.

In addition to regulating the air-fuel mixture, the engine control module also controls other vital functions of the engine, such as the idle speed, variable valve timing, and turbocharger boost. By continuously monitoring and adjusting these parameters, the ECM ensures smooth and efficient operation of the engine under various driving conditions.

Moreover, the engine control module plays a crucial role in diagnosing and identifying any potential issues with the engine or transmission system. If a sensor detects a problem, the ECM will trigger the check engine light and store a trouble code in its memory. Mechanics can then use diagnostic tools to retrieve these codes, pinpoint the source of the issue, and make necessary repairs.

Furthermore, the engine control module is also responsible for controlling the transmission system in vehicles equipped with automatic transmissions. By analyzing data from various sensors, such as the vehicle speed sensor and throttle position sensor, the ECM can adjust the shifting points of the transmission to ensure smooth and efficient gear changes.

Overall, the engine control module is a key component of modern vehicles, playing a vital role in regulating and optimizing the performance of the engine and transmission system. Without this crucial system, it would be impossible to achieve the level of efficiency, performance, and reliability that drivers have come to expect from their vehicles. The engine control module (ECM), also known as the powertrain control module (PCM) or engine control unit (ECU), is a critical component of a vehicle's overall operation.

It serves as the brain of the engine, controlling various functions and ensuring optimal performance. In this blog post, we will delve into the intricacies of the ECM, exploring its functions, importance, and maintenance.

Functions of the ECM

The ECM is responsible for monitoring and controlling a wide range of functions within the vehicle's engine. Some of its key functions include:

1. Fuel Injection: The ECM regulates the amount of fuel injected into the engine to ensure proper combustion and efficient performance.

2. Ignition Timing: The ECM controls the timing of the ignition system to ensure optimal combustion and engine efficiency.

3. Emissions Control: The ECM monitors and adjusts various systems within the engine to minimize harmful emissions and comply with environmental regulations.

4. Transmission Control: In vehicles with automatic transmissions, the ECM communicates with the transmission control module to ensure smooth shifting and optimal performance.

5. Engine Performance: The ECM continuously monitors various sensors and data points to adjust engine parameters and optimize performance under various driving conditions.

Importance of the ECM

The ECM plays a crucial role in the overall operation of a vehicle. Without a properly functioning ECM, the engine may not run efficiently or may even fail to start. Some of the key reasons why the ECM is so important include:

1. Engine Performance: The ECM ensures that the engine runs smoothly and efficiently, delivering optimal power and fuel efficiency.

2. Emissions Compliance: The ECM helps minimize harmful emissions by monitoring and adjusting engine parameters to comply with environmental regulations.

3. Diagnostic Capabilities: The ECM is equipped with onboard diagnostics that can help identify and troubleshoot engine issues, making it easier to pinpoint and address problems.

4. Vehicle Safety: The ECM is designed to safeguard the engine from potential damage by monitoring critical parameters and adjusting settings as needed.

Maintenance of the ECM

To ensure the ECM functions properly and continues to provide optimal performance, regular maintenance is essential. Some key maintenance practices for the ECM include:

1. Regular Inspections: Periodically checking the ECM for signs of damage or corrosion can help prevent potential issues before they escalate.

2. Software Updates: Keeping the software of the ECM up-to-date can help improve performance and address any potential bugs or issues.

3. Sensor Checks: Inspecting and calibrating sensors that communicate with the ECM can help ensure accurate data and optimal engine performance.

4. Professional Service: If any issues arise with the ECM, it is essential to seek professional assistance from a qualified technician who can diagnose and address the problem effectively.

The engine control module (ECM), also known as the powertrain control module (PCM) or engine control unit (ECU), is a crucial component in modern vehicles.

It serves as the brain of the vehicle, controlling various systems and functions to ensure optimal performance, efficiency, and overall reliability.

The ECM is a complex computer system that constantly monitors and adjusts various parameters in the vehicle to ensure smooth operation. It collects data from sensors throughout the vehicle, such as the oxygen sensor, mass airflow sensor, and throttle position sensor, to determine the optimal fuel and air mixture for combustion in the engine. It also controls other important functions, such as ignition timing, idle speed, and emissions control.

One of the key functions of the ECM is fuel injection control. The ECM determines the amount of fuel to inject into the engine based on factors such as engine speed, load, and temperature. This ensures that the engine runs efficiently and produces the right amount of power for the given driving conditions. By adjusting the fuel injection process, the ECM helps to optimize fuel economy and reduce emissions.

In addition to fuel injection control, the ECM also plays a critical role in engine performance and emissions control. It regulates the ignition timing to ensure that the spark plugs fire at the right time, maximizing power and efficiency. It also monitors the exhaust emissions and adjusts various parameters to reduce harmful pollutants and meet emissions regulations.

The ECM is a highly sophisticated system that requires regular maintenance and monitoring to ensure proper functioning. If the ECM malfunctions or fails, it can lead to a variety of issues such as poor engine performance, reduced fuel efficiency, and increased emissions. Common signs of ECM problems include rough idling, stalling, and hesitation during acceleration.

To diagnose ECM issues, a trained technician will use specialized diagnostic equipment to read error codes stored in the system. These codes can help identify the source of the problem and guide the technician in making necessary repairs. In some cases, a simple software update or reprogramming of the ECM may fix the issue. However, more serious problems may require replacing the ECM altogether.
